DPM condemns lathicharge
Srinagar, Dec 5: Democratic Political Movement chairman, Firdous Ahmad Shah has strongly condemned, what he said, the indiscriminate lathicharge on the Ashura mourners by the police on Sunday, terming it blatant interference in religious affairs of people. In a statement, Shah expressed concern over the deteriorating health of its incarcerated leader Shakeel Ahmad Bhat in Kot Bhalwal Jail, Jammu. He alleged that Shakeel was denied proper medical facilities.
